    AngleArc Class
    In This Topic
    Represents the shape that is used to define the content of the MaterialProgressBarCircular.

    Inheritance Hierarchy

    System.Object
       System.Windows.Threading.DispatcherObject
          System.Windows.DependencyObject
             System.Windows.Media.Visual
                System.Windows.UIElement
                   System.Windows.FrameworkElement
                      System.Windows.Shapes.Shape
                         Xceed.Wpf.Toolkit.Primitives.ShapeBase
                            Xceed.Wpf.Toolkit.AngleArc
